Card Keys. User hereby agrees to keep any card key and/or locker key provided to User in User’s possession and control at all times until required or requested to surrender the same, and in no event shall User lend or otherwise transfer its card key or locker key to any other person. In the event User shall lose or misplace its card key or locker key, or in the event User’s card key or locker key shall be stolen, User shall immediately notify Landlord and Operator in writing. User further agrees that, in the event either (i) User’s employment with Tenant is terminated for any reason, or (ii) Tenant shall be in default under its lease with Landlord, Operator may immediately de-activate User’s key card and User shall immediately surrender its card key and locker key to Operator. User hereby acknowledges that the card key and locker key are and shall remain the property of Operator, and User agrees to return the same to Operator upon the expiration (or sooner termination) of Tenant’s lease or any earlier date on which Operator is entitled to de-activate said card key. Inoperative (but not de-activated) cards keys will be replaced at no charge, but lost and de-activated card keys will be replaced (or reactivated, as the case may be) at a cost established by the Operator from time to time. Lost locker keys shall be replaced, and the appropriate locker re-keyed, at a cost established by the Operator from time to time.
Card Keys. Lessor shall provide security access cards to Lessee’s current and future employees at no additional charge except that Lessee shall reimburse Lessor for the actual cost of any replacement cards issued. Lessee shall have the right to control the programming and operations of the card access system, provided that Lessee will reasonably cooperate with other tenants in the Building in order to coordinate the operations of such security system.

Card Keys. Landlord, at no cost to you, will provide you with up to six card keys for each 1,000 r.s.f. of space that the Premises is comprised of. Any additional card keys requested by you shall be paid for by you at Landlord's then current rate. The existing current rate is $15.00 per card key. At your request, the Construction Drawings will provide for the restriction of elevator access to single tenant floors and the cost to provide for such restricted access will be included as part of the Interior Buildout Cost.
Card Keys. Lessor shall furnish Lessee with a minimum of six card keys for entering the Leased Premises. Additional card keys will be furnished at a charge by Lessor on an order signed by Lessee or Lessee's authorized representative. All such card keys shall remain the property of Lessor. Lessee shall not change the locks without Lessor's permission, and Lessee shall not make, or permit to be made, any duplicate card keys, except those furnished by Lessor. Upon termination of this Lease, Lessee shall surrender to Lessor all card keys to the Leased Premises and give to Lessor the explanation of the combination of all locks for safes, safe cabinets and vault doors, if any, installed in the Leased Premises by Lessee.
